Video for "Cry" (74,939)
by Mimi L. from Empower Your Highlighter
| |
|
|
So during the Elusive Chanteuse tour, while Mariah sang "Cry", the monitors on the back played a beautiful video of her dancing with Anthony Burrell, the visuals were stunning, so this fan made this video dubbing the live version video with the CD version of the song. The visuals playing in the monitor are stunning. And while Mariah dances, she looks beautiful and graceful and not stiff. If you check out the video of Mariah performing "You're Mine" at the BET awards, you can see a longer version of these visuals with Anthony along with visuals of her wearing a black dress on the screen behind her. So gorgeous and so ethereal.
